Databricks’ Market Position and Competitive Landscape
Alright, let's talk about where Databricks stands in the grand scheme of things! The data analytics market is huge and competitive. Databricks has carved out a significant niche for itself, mainly because of its unified data analytics platform. This platform brings together data engineering, data science, and business analytics, making it easier for companies to get insights from their data. Its main competitors are other big players in the tech industry, but Databricks stands out by offering a comprehensive, easy-to-use solution. Its focus on open-source technologies, such as Apache Spark, has been a key differentiator, attracting developers and businesses alike. Competitors: Key Players in the Data Analytics Space
Of course, Databricks isn't alone in this race. The competitive landscape includes some heavy hitters, each vying for a piece of the pie. These include well-established companies such as Amazon Web Services (AWS), Microsoft Azure, and Google Cloud Platform (GCP). These giants offer their own data analytics services, competing directly with Databricks. Then there are other specialized players like Snowflake and Cloudera. Each competitor brings its own strengths to the table, and the competition drives innovation in the industry.
